And something else that remained constant was your anxiety the night before. Today, we’re here to cure your anxiety by helping you prepare well. Read below to know how-

  1. Relax first- Right before you walk in your interview take deep breaths and give yourself some positive pep talk.
  2. Dress code- Formals are the most ideal outfit for interviews. A black suit with a white or light shirt is pretty much the industrial norm. Pay equal attention to your appearance.
  3. Posture- A stooping and a shaking figure never casts a good impression. Walk in confidently. Sit straight in the chair offered, with both feet firmly planted on the ground. Maintain eye contact as you talk and avoid fidgeting with your pen or coat buttons.
  4. Resume- It’s YOUR RESUME that does the talking in the beginning. The panel interview mostly revolves around your resume. Your academics, extra curriculars, achievements, internship etc.

We also have listed a few popular interview questions and how you can ace them.

Tell me a little about yourself- This is most often an attempt to put the candidate at ease and start the interview off on a more conversational note. This is a great opportunity to set the tone for the rest of the interview.

What made you select this college?-  Offer a response that will present you as the ideal candidate for the job.

What would you consider to be your major strength/weakness?- Be thoughtful. Describe a strength that is in some way related to the position or your work style in general. Always present any perceived weakness in a positive manner.
Where do you see yourself in the next five years?- This is a good opportunity to show that you have some clear career goals and the goals are tied to helping the company with its mission.
